Housekeeping Supervisor
A Maids' Manager is a crucial member of any hotel’s team. Their primary duty is to oversee the daily operations of the housekeeping staff, ensuring that all areas are kept clean and sanitary. They create cleaning schedules and supervise staff performance. A successful Housekeeping Supervisor must possess strong leadership skills, attention to detail, and a commitment to providing excellent service.
Their responsibilities can include instructing new staff members, resolving guest issues, controlling supplies and inventory, and ensuring compliance with all safety regulations.

Personal Assistant
A concierge is a individual who provides a comprehensive array of services to guests at hotels, residences. Their role is to ensure that residents or visitors have an enjoyable and smooth experience.
From making bookings for restaurants and shows to arranging logistics, a concierge goes above and beyond to cater to the needs of their clientele. They often have in-depth knowledge with the local area, providing valuable recommendations on restaurants.
Their proficiency extends beyond simply providing information; they are adept at solving issues and curating unforgettable experiences for their guests. A committed concierge is a valuable asset to any property, contributing to the overall happiness of its residents or visitors.

A Restaurant Server
In the fast-paced environment of a restaurant, a server plays a essential role in ensuring a memorable dining experience for customers. They are responsible for assisting guests, taking their dinner choices, and delivering food and beverages with a courteous demeanor. A skilled server possesses strong customer service skills, the ability to manage multiple tables efficiently, and familiarity of the menu items and specials.
- He or she also clear plates, top off drinks, and address customer needs.
- Moreover, a competent server ensures a clean and tidy dining area.

F&B Director
As a vital member of the executive team, the Food and Beverage Director manages all aspects of the department's food and beverage services. This spanst developing menus, sourcing ingredients, coaching staff, ensuring high levels of service, and controlling the operational costs. The Director also collaborates closely with other departments to develop a positive guest environment.

Housekeeping Staff
A Cleaner is responsible for maintaining the suites in a resort. Their daily duties include making beds, emptying trash, supplying amenities, and ensuring a clean environment for guests. They frequently operate their duties in intervals, ensuring that the property is kept to a high of cleanliness.
Laundry Attendant
A Laundry Associate is responsible for taking care of clothing. Their tasks often include, sorting, washing, spinning, folding, and returning garments. They may also be responsible for maintaining laundry equipment and offering support to clients.
